04 V8 Limited 4 Lo flashing

Hello all my 2004 4runner has the dreaded po1782 (internal transfer case jam) and will not go out of the “4Lo” mode. It is actually in 4hi but the actuator is jammed in between. The issue I have is this truck has never been in standing water and I’ve used 4lo every few months. when I popped the cover off the actuator box it looked very good inside, no corrosion. So this leads me to think there is a wiring issue or control issue. I’m not super familiar with these auto Tcase/center diff jobs, but I’ve been told there is two forks inside (center diff l/ul, and 4hi/lo). I think I have only viewed the center diff rod and motor. If so how do I completely remove the unitl to get to it. This was after being in a heated shop for 3 months with the motor out of it for exhaust manifolds. I thought maybe a pinched wire or bad ground but have traced a couple and not had any luck. Other than the 4 lo light I don’t have any other lights other than a tpms fault (befote this issue) I’m fairly mechanically inclined and this had been a conundrum.
